
When you think about fast, dependable estimating, the first phrase that should come to mind is item coding. A clear, consistent code for every material, labor task, and subcontract allowance is the only way to avoid missed costs and fuzzy margins. At CountBricks, we have elevated item coding from a spreadsheet chore to an AI-driven advantage that speaks your language—literally. Say the word “2x4 top plate,” and our voice engine tags it with the right code, price, and supplier in seconds. The result: reliable estimates, professional proposals, and airtight job costing for every residential project you take on.
An item code is a short, standardized label that uniquely identifies a line item in your estimate. Think of it as a barcode for construction data. Instead of typing “interior semi-gloss paint, white,” you might assign the code FIN-PNT-INT-SG. The code does three important things:
• Links the item to a live material price from your preferred supplier
• Groups similar tasks for quick quantity takeoffs and budget reports
• Maintains consistency across estimates, purchase orders, and invoices
Without item coding, you are stuck searching for “paint, white,” “white paint,” or “INT paint” and hoping they all mean the same thing. With CountBricks, one code rules them all, and your books finally speak the same language as your field crews.
• Prevents duplicate or forgotten items that erode profit
• Accelerates voice-to-estimate workflows by matching spoken items to codes
• Supports data-driven project reviews by grouping costs per phase
• Simplifies change orders because every item is traceable
• Creates bullet-proof audit trails for warranty or legal claims
Generic coding libraries feel like paperwork. CountBricks turns them into a competitive edge by combining three innovations:
• Real-Time Voice Capture: While you discuss scope on-site, our mobile app converts speech into line items and applies the right codes automatically.
• AI-Powered Mapping: Our algorithm cross-checks supplier catalogs, local building codes, and your historic budgets to assign the most accurate code every time.
• Live Price Feed: Codes are linked to streaming material costs, trade rates, and markup rules, so the moment prices move, your estimate stays current.
1. Open a new project in the CountBricks dashboard.
2. Tap the microphone and describe the work: “Supply and install 200 square feet of LVP flooring in the master bedroom.”
3. The AI parses your sentence, matches “LVP flooring” to an internal code (FIN-FLR-LVP), and references the correct supplier price.
4. Quantity, unit cost, and labor hours appear instantly in your estimate.
5. Review, adjust markup if required, and hit “Save.” You just coded, priced, and captured a line item without touching the keyboard.
You can start from our pre-built residential template or import your own spreadsheet. Either way, follow these best practices:
• Keep codes short (4-12 characters) so they are easy to remember on site
• Use intuitive prefixes to group divisions (e.g., FRM for framing, FIN for finishes)
• Attach default waste factors to each code—no more manual 10% add-ons
• Store preferred suppliers, delivery lead times, and crew productivity rates with every code
As your company grows, CountBricks automatically reports which codes drive the most revenue and which need tighter control.
• Adopt the CSI MasterFormat as a backbone, then fine-tune for residential specifics
• Review unused codes quarterly and archive what you no longer install
• Color-code high-risk items (custom millwork, allowances) in the dashboard for instant visibility
The real power of item coding appears when every phase of the project talks to the same database. Upload a PDF blueprint, run an AI takeoff, and CountBricks places the quantity results directly into the coded estimate lines. When the homeowner signs, those same codes populate purchase orders and progress invoices. Field supervisors log hours against the identical codes in our mobile timesheets, giving you real-time cost-to-complete forecasts.
Ready to ditch the spreadsheet shuffle? Visit CountBricks.com/services to schedule a live demo. In thirty minutes, we’ll convert one of your recent bids into a fully coded, cost-synced estimate and show you how to generate a branded proposal with a single click. Residential construction has never moved this fast—or this accurately.

Riverside Custom Homes, a CountBricks client specializing in mid-range infill builds, once relied on a 12-tab spreadsheet to manage estimates. Each estimator created their own naming conventions—“LV flooring,” “lux vinyl plank,” or simply “LVP.” The result was predictable: inconsistent pricing, purchase orders that didn’t match the estimate, and 4% average profit slippage.
After adopting CountBricks item coding, Riverside imported 468 unique materials and tasks, assigning each a clear code linked to live supplier feeds. In the first quarter:
• Estimate turnaround dropped from 5 days to 1.2 days
• Variance between estimated and actual material cost fell below 1%
• Profit margin improved by 3.6% without raising prices
• Standardize Now: Even a small library of 50 high-impact codes will eliminate the majority of double-entries.
• Train the Team: Run a lunchtime walkthrough of the code structure so supers and subs can tag hours correctly.
• Review Monthly: Use the CountBricks dashboard to spot codes with creeping costs and renegotiate with suppliers.
• Automate Updates: Activate live pricing so you never quote lumber at last month’s rate.
If you have ever lost money because “flooring allowance” was entered three different ways, it is time to move to code-driven estimating. Book your personalized onboarding at CountBricks.com/consultation and see how item coding can safeguard every dollar of your next residential build.